is using sticker wrap or leather cover for your IU legal?

 

Wrapping your IU unit has no legal/illegal issues.

 

Yeah Wrapping It With Stickers Is Not Illegal But Make Sure The Barcode At The Side & Security Labels At The Bottom Is Not Affected As In When You Peel Off The Sticker In The Future, It Will Not Affect The Labels Because If Lets Say They Are Tampered Or Torn, Your Warranty Is Gone.

 

My Previous IU Unit I Pasted A Tinted Sticker Over & When I Peeled It Off, The Barcode At The Side Came Off Too And When My IU Was Spoilt, They Say Warranty Is Gone Because Barcode Is Missing Which Means It Has Been Tampered. LIKE WTF???!

 

hi guys..u all got face this problem before?

 

carburator gena rainwater seep in after heavy downpour. (those raining cats & dogs type.heavy pouring for few hours.)

and then cannot move..maybe can still start but once u rev throttle, engine will stall..

 

i got this twice already and had to tow back to shope where they washed the carburator.

 

i mean....is this a common problem for spark? Since the middle ventilation holes are right where the carburator is..

 

but can't be right??! then every rainy day, sparks on the road won't be moving?

 

I Used To Experience It On My Previous Bike Which Is An X1. The Prob Was That Some Of The Screws At The Carb Keep On Getting Loose Due To Vibration So Water Could Seep In. After Cleaning The Carb & Tightening All The Screws, The Prob Was Gone.
